Transportation agencies traditionally had a very steady workforce. The combination of changes in young people’s work patterns and the economic changes that drive workforce availability requires that agencies need to act more proactively on how to deliver transportation programs. Research is needed to understand the behavioral patterns and mechanisms to both mitigate variability in workforce availability and what can be done proactively to benefit the agency.

Objectives
- Understand changes in transportation workforce behavior
- Understand the economic forces that change transportation workforce behavior
- Determine ways that transportation agencies can better manage with these forces
- Recommend steps that agencies can take to work within these forces
